YOUNGSTERS donned their wellies and got creative at a crafty event.

Children at the Secret Garden Nursery in Brinsea Road, Congresbury, explored the outdoors during an activities week.

The staff and children spent most days in the open air, exploring materials like paint, sand, mud, hay, leaves and branches, as well as boxes and tubes.

Nursery owner, Stefanie Metcalfe, said: "We believe it is so important that children are able to spend time outside, interacting freely with their environment.

"The youngsters made dens and pretend bonfires and got as muddy as they liked. "They loved it.
